The mandate will be in effect until January 31st at 11:59 p.m. Mayor Charlie Carley has signed the executive order requiring masks to be worn indoors to mitigate and combat the spread of COVID-19, effective New Years Eve. The South Brunswick school district will be operating remotely for the next two weeks, beginning Jan. 3 to Jan. 14. From Dec. 20 to Dec. 30 saw a dramatic increase in cases, by nearly 400 percent, health officials said.
